it's not very accurate though. it makes alot of assumptions. like most people that don't know 4runners would say you can't put 285/75/16's on a lifted 3rd gen, 4wheel parts didn't even know how to lift mine and I had to tell them the model number for the SAWs to order me and the model number for the OME springs too.
